Manchester United hoping to snap up AC Milan defender

Manchester United have reportedly expressed an interest in snapping up AC Milan defender Leonardo Bonucci.

The Serie A giants are currently embroiled in an ownership dispute less than two years on from being taken over by a wealthy Chinese consortium.

As a result, Bonucci’s salary may have to be taken off the wage bill in order to meet the requirements of Financial Fair Play (FFP).

According to Daily Express, Jose Mourinho is keen to strengthen his back line further ahead of a Premier League title tilt and could take advantage of Milan’s financial issues by making a £30m bid for the experienced centre-back.

Man United have made two signings this summer, recruiting Portuguese defender Diogo Dalot from Porto and obtaining the services of Brazil midfielder Fred from Shakhtar Donetsk.
